Remote Epic Cadence Analyst

A client in the Louisville, KY area is looking for a remote Epic Cadence Analyst.
They will be focused on the build and support of the build when it comes to Cadence / Prelude, including tickets and end user support around this module.
This person will be responsible for three main areas of focus:
Referrals, document building, and security.
The candidate will have to be a self-starter, who is able to work in a fast-paced environment.
The day-to-day activities will be that of a true analyst, focusing on building and configuring applications within Epic to meet customers data requirements.
-Decision tree badge on Epic certification - RTE (Real Time Eligibility) Certification -Epic Cadence / Prelude Certification (active) -Epic Referrals Certified -4-6 years of experience as an Epic Cadence Analyst for at least 2 different employers - 4-6 years of build, optimization, and support experience Recommended Skills Self Motivation User Assistance Decision Tree Learning Estimated Salary: $20 to $28 per hour based on qualifications.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
